Kagoro killings: Anglican Church calls for provision of relief materials to victims of attack

Archdeacon of the Holy Trinity Cathedral of the Anglican Diocese of Kafanchan in Kaduna State, North-West Nigeria, Yakubu Dauda, wants the government to as a matter of urgency provide relief materials to the victims of recent attack that killed 40 people in Malagum and some villages in Kaura Local Government Area.

While condemning the deadly attack, Dauda called for immediate arrest of the terrorists who carried out the killings.

The clergyman made the call during the Christmas Thanksgiving Service where he prayed to God for hope, peace, and unity in Nigeria and urged the people to vote wisely in the 2023 elections.

Archdeacon Dauda believes that if politicians, traditional leaders, and religious leaders from diverse ethnic groups will promote national unity in their localities, Nigeria will be a better place for everyone.

Meanwhile, an elder in the church, Ibrahim Namadi appealed to the people of Southern Kaduna to assist the security operatives with relevant information to maintain peace and orderliness in the area.
